阿里使用哪个linux版本做服务器?

阿里巴巴服务器背后的Linux选择:深度解析与技术策略

在当今的云计算和大数据时代,大型科技公司如阿里巴巴在构建其庞大且高性能的服务器基础设施时,选择操作系统是至关重要的决策。众所周知,Linux作为开源的操作系统,以其稳定性、灵活性和成本效益深受企业级用户的青睐。那么,阿里巴巴究竟倾向于使用哪个Linux版本来驱动其服务器呢?

首先,让我们得出结论:阿里巴巴的主要服务器环境倾向于使用基于Debian的Ubuntu Linux和Red Hat Enterprise Linux(RHEL)这两个版本。这两个Linux发行版都是业界公认的稳定性和性能的象征,且得到了广泛的企业级支持。

Ubuntu Linux是基于Debian的,以其简洁易用的桌面环境和强大的服务器工具而闻名。阿里巴巴之所以选择Ubuntu,一方面是因为其社区活跃,有大量的开源软件和社区支持,这有助于快速解决问题和进行定制化开发。另一方面,Ubuntu的滚动更新策略使得系统始终保持最新,这对于追求技术创新和快速响应市场变化的阿里巴巴来说是非常重要的。

然而,Red Hat Enterprise Linux (RHEL)也是阿里巴巴服务器环境中的重要组成部分。RHEL是由Red Hat公司开发并维护的商业版Linux,它以其稳定性和安全性著称。对于像阿里巴巴这样的大型企业来说,商业支持和服务级别协议(SLA)是关键考虑因素。RHEL提供了更高级别的技术支持和长期的维护保障,确保了系统的持续运行和数据的安全性。

此外,RHEL还与许多商业软件和硬件平台高度兼容,这使得阿里巴巴能够无缝集成其内部的复杂IT生态系统。而且,RHEL与Kubernetes等容器管理平台的集成也使得阿里云的容器服务能够高效运行。

当然,阿里巴巴并非只依赖单一的Linux版本,而是根据不同的业务需求和技术场景灵活选用。例如,在处理实时数据处理和分布式计算任务时,可能更倾向于使用Apache Hadoop和Spark等大数据处理框架,这些框架通常在基于Debian或RHEL的Linux平台上运行更为顺畅。

总的来说,阿里巴巴在Linux的选择上,兼顾了开源社区的活跃度、商业支持的可靠性以及与现有IT架构的兼容性。通过精细的组合和定制,它确保了服务器的高效运作,为全球用户提供稳定、安全和可扩展的云计算服务。未来,由于技术的不断演进,阿里巴巴可能会继续探索和采用新的Linux分支或者自研操作系统,以适应不断变化的业务需求和技术趋势。

未经允许不得转载:秒懂云 » 阿里使用哪个linux版本做服务器?